Switch from monoallelic to biallelic human IGF2 promoter methylation during aging and carcinogenesis.
Proceedings of the National Academy of Sciences of the United States of America - 15 Oct 1996
Issa J P, Vertino P M, Boehm C D, Newsham I F, Baylin S B
Abstract excerpt
We have previously linked aging, carcinogenesis, and de novo methylation within the promoter of the estrogen receptor (ER) gene in human colon. We now examine the dynamics of this process for the imprinted gene for insulin-like growth factor II (IGF2). In young individuals, the P2-4 promoters of IGF2 are methylated exclusively on the silenced maternal allele. During aging, this promoter methylation becomes more...
